1. Lake ThetisCervantes Lake Thetis is a saline coastal lake in the mid-western region of Western Australia. The lake is situated east of the small town Cervantes, 2 kilometres inland from the Indian Ocean, on a Quaternary limestone pavement. From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ia.

Eneabba brothers Ben and Sean Plozza have developed a new concept to help Western Australian grain growers alleviate severe non-wetting soil issues.
The ‘Plozza Plow’ is a one-way disc Chamberlain plough with market garden-style discs to invert the top non-wetting sandy and gravel layer of the soil, while also achieving the benefit of incorporating lime at depth.
